How Much Does Each Part of Kitchen faucet replacement Cost?

The cost to replace a kitchen faucet in Chandler ranges from $150 to $550, with most homeowners paying around $300. Your actual cost depends on several factors specific to your home and the Phoenix-Mesa market.

🔌
Faucet Type (Single-Handle, Pull-Down, Touchless)

Basic single-handle faucets cost $50–$150 while pull-down sprayer and touchless models range from $150–$500+ for the fixture alone.

Existing Plumbing Condition

Corroded supply lines or stuck shut-off valves may need replacement during the swap, adding $50–$150 in unexpected work.

📏
Supply Line Replacement

New braided stainless steel supply lines ($10–$20 each) are recommended during any faucet replacement to prevent future leaks.

🔧
Sprayer Configuration

Pull-down and pull-out sprayers cost more than fixed spouts and may require a larger mounting hole or deck plate.

🏗️
Soap Dispenser

Adding a soap dispenser requires an extra countertop hole if one doesn't exist — drilling through granite or quartz adds $50–$100.

Can I replace a kitchen faucet myself?

Kitchen faucet replacement is a good DIY project for handy homeowners. You'll need an adjustable wrench, basin wrench, and plumber's tape. The hardest part is usually reaching the connections under the sink. Budget 1–2 hours for the job.

What's the best type of kitchen faucet?

Pull-down faucets are the most popular for their versatility — the sprayer head pulls down into the sink for rinsing and cleaning. Look for ceramic disc valves (drip-free), a high-arc spout for filling tall pots, and a reputable brand with good warranty coverage.
